  • Patent number: 9247484
    Abstract: Packet data network (PDN) connection requests from a mobile device may be limited by the mobile device. In one implementation, the mobile device may track an amount of successful PDN connection requests issued by the mobile device over a cellular network and maintain a timer value relating to an amount of time over which the successful PDN connection requests have been tracked. The mobile device may determine an allowable number of PDN connection requests and compare the amount of successful PDN connection requests to the allowable number of PDN connection requests. The mobile device may determine, based on the comparison, whether to block a PDN connection request from being issued to the cellular network.

  • Patent number: 9230377
    Abstract: Systems and methods for providing mobile device security are disclosed. In some implementations, a request for access to a security mechanism is received at a user terminal. A short-range radio connection of the user terminal at a time of receiving the request for access is identified responsive to the request. A memory of the user terminal is accessed to determine whether the identified short-range radio connection corresponds to a user-identified secure radio connection. Upon determining that the radio connection corresponds to the user-identified secure radio connection, the user is granted access to the security mechanism without soliciting the user of the user terminal for a predetermined security input. Upon determining that the radio connection does not correspond to the user-identified secure radio connection, the user is solicited for the predetermined security input.

  • Patent number: 9232426
    Abstract: The re-transmission of transmission units (TUs) received in a communication device over a communication link is controlled to improve the information carrying capacity of the link. A received TU has an associated service characteristic indicative of a quality of service (QOS) for the TU. The service characteristic is associated with a select set of key performance indicators (KPIs), such as measures of packet error, packet delay, packet delay variation, and/or packet loss experienced by TUs on the communication link. Upon receipt of a TU, the performance of the communication link is evaluated with respect to each KPI in the select set to obtain a corresponding measurement value, and the measurement values are compared to corresponding threshold values. Upon determining that a determined performance value does not satisfy a corresponding threshold value for a KPI in the select set, re-transmission of the TU is requested.

  • Patent number: 9232303
    Abstract: An apparatus is disclosed for enhancing the sound level of portable devices by providing a sound reflector between the portable device and a case. The sound reflector includes a shield which functions to redirect output from rear facing speakers toward the front. The sound reflector can be extended for redirecting sound or retracted when not in use. A case incorporating a retractable sound reflector is also disclosed.
